Chapter 7. (Story) Madam Rides the Bus
Madam Rides the Bus, written by Vallikkannan, is a heartwarming story about an eight-year-old village girl named Valli. Curious and determined, Valli dreams of taking a bus ride to the nearby town all by herself. Through careful planning, patience, and courage, she fulfills her dream. During the journey, she observes the outside world with great excitement and also learns an important lesson about life and death. The story highlights a child's innocence, curiosity, confidence, and growing understanding of the world.
Story Summary (English)
Valliammai, popularly called Valli, is an eight-year-old girl who lives in a small village. She has no friends of her age to play with, so her favourite pastime is standing at the front door of her house and watching the activities on the street. Among all the things she sees every day, the bus travelling between her village and the nearby town attracts her the most. Gradually, she develops a strong desire to travel on that bus at least once.
Valli patiently collects information about the bus journey by listening to conversations between the villagers and regular passengers. She learns that the town is six miles away, the journey takes forty-five minutes, and the fare is thirty paise for one side. Determined to make the journey, she carefully saves sixty paise by avoiding small pleasures such as buying toys, balloons, and peppermints. She also plans the perfect time for the trip while her mother takes an afternoon nap.
One afternoon, Valli boards the bus all by herself. The cheerful conductor jokingly calls her "Madam," which makes the other passengers laugh. At first, Valli feels shy, but she soon becomes comfortable. She enjoys every moment of the journey, admiring the beautiful green fields, canals, palm trees, distant hills, and the lively scenes along the road. The comfortable bus, the passing scenery, and the excitement of travelling alone fill her with happiness.
During the journey, Valli laughs heartily when she sees a young cow running playfully in front of the bus. After reaching the town, she refuses to get down because her only wish is to experience the bus ride. She immediately buys another ticket for the return journey. On the way back, however, she sees the same cow lying dead on the roadside after being hit by a speeding vehicle. The shocking sight deeply saddens her and changes her cheerful mood.
After returning home safely, Valli quietly enters her house without telling anyone about her adventure. While listening to a conversation between her mother and aunt about life and the world, she silently realises that people often know about many things but do not fully understand them. Her first bus journey not only fulfills her dream but also gives her a deeper understanding of life, experience, and reality.

Character Sketch
1. Valli
Valli is an intelligent, curious, confident, determined, and independent eight-year-old girl. She carefully plans her journey, saves money with patience, and shows courage by travelling alone. At the same time, her innocence and sensitivity are reflected when she becomes deeply saddened after seeing the dead cow.
2. The Bus Conductor
The conductor is cheerful, humorous, friendly, and kind-hearted. He treats Valli with affection, calls her "Madam" in a playful manner, and helps make her first journey enjoyable and comfortable.
Theme / Message of the Story
The story highlights the innocence, curiosity, courage, and determination of childhood. It also shows that real experiences teach valuable lessons that books alone cannot. Valli's journey helps her understand both the joy of exploration and the reality of life and death, making her emotionally wiser.
Difficult Words and Meanings
1. Pastime – An activity done for enjoyment.
2. Fascinating – Extremely interesting.
3. Overwhelming – Very strong or powerful.
4. Wistfully – Longingly or sadly.
5. Discreet – Careful and sensible.
6. Commandingly – In a confident and authoritative manner.
7. Gleaming – Shining brightly.
8. Repulsive – Causing strong dislike.
9. Haughtily – Proudly and arrogantly.
10. Mimicking – Copying someone's speech or actions.
11. Thriftily – In a careful, money-saving manner.
12. Resolutely – With firm determination.
13. Thoroughfare – A busy public road.
14. Merchandise – Goods offered for sale.
15. Haunted – Continuously remembered in a disturbing way.
